  • Publication number: 20160369990
    Abstract: A refill indication system includes a panel having a first side, a second side and a perimeter edge. Each of the first and second sides is planar. A support is attached to the first side adjacent to the perimeter edge and spaces the first side from a surface when the first side faces the surface and the support abuts the surface. A light emitter is mounted in the panel. A switch is electrically coupled to the light emitter. The switch is mounted on the first side and is spaced from the perimeter edge. The light emitter is turned on when the switch is actuated. The switch is actuated to an on position when an object is placed on the switch and actuated to an off position when first side is free of supporting the object.

  • Patent number: 5692859
    Abstract: A linear cable laying engine has a pair of endless belts (12,14) having a substantial length (16,18) in respective face to face opposition, and means for applying force to the belts to cause them to grip a cable (42) between the opposed faces.
